Garters within the Heart Ages and Camelot
The sleeve garter has been producing sporadic appearances in fashion because the Heart Ages, throughout a time when leg garters have been a frequent accent for every gents and gals — within the period previous to elastic, every sexes employed leg garters to take care of up their stockings. These garters ended up usually fanciful, extremely ornamental, and worn to be proven, a craze that dominated males’s garments clear by means of the 18th century.
Glorious Britain’s ultra-distinctive Most Noble Buy of the Garter, in actuality, was a services or products of this interval, proudly owning been based by King Edward the III someday within the mid-14th century as a fellowship of chivalrous knights certain by the image of the garter. The enterprise, nonetheless in existence now, is proscribed to royalty and worldwide sovereigns and is considered simply some of the elite societies within the globe.
The rationale Edward III selected to make use of the garter as a picture of his fraternity is shrouded in legend and has been the topic of a incredible deal of controversy and dialogue. Some hint Edward’s inspiration to the Crusades, the place knights ended up claimed to have tied garters about their legs as talismans that might assure them of victory. Different folks say the supply may be traced to the leather-based straps that knights of the time interval wore throughout their arms to bind elements of their armor. The inspiration of the garter has additionally been hooked as much as none apart from well-known Camelot, precisely the place many purchasers of King Arthur’s Spherical Desk, most notably Sir Gawain, wore garters as a indicator of solidarity, loyalty, purity, and brotherhood.
By the conclusion of Elizabethan England, arm and sleeve garters skilled principally light from vogue however had been being destined to make an enormous comeback throughout the nineteenth century. With the Industrial Revolution arrived the introduction of mass manufactured textiles, incomes garments like normal trousers and shirts way more reasonably priced to the common explicit individual. However mass generated attire, which couldn’t be pre-fitted to the wearer, tended to come back in solely common measurements when most males’s shirts have been produced with sleeves in just one explicit size, added extended. Arm garters have been a handy and, for these individuals who couldn’t pay for his or her private tailor, very important solution to modify the size of 1’s sleeves by sustaining extra product bunched earlier talked about the elbow across the shoulder.
Sleeve Garters within the nineteenth Century and the Wild West
However technology approaches improved about time, main to the number of shirt dimensions on the market at present and eradicating the should have for arm garters, there have been being numerous different helpful issues that assisted protect the sleeve garter well-known amongst specified circles. Amongst info printers, workplace clerks, and different gurus who labored near ink (in an period the place most paperwork had been even now generated by hand), arm garters had been being a solution to maintain one’s sleeves clear up and smudge-absolutely free.
No much less sensible had been the issues for card players in regards to the Previous West and in different places, who incessantly wore arm garters as a result of it manufactured hiding playing cards up one’s sleeves difficult. A card participant carrying sleeve garters was successfully asserting that he was equally real and incredible enough that he did not must should cheat. Arm garters are sometimes worn by card sellers at casinos even presently for these motives, although presently they’re regarded additional as a engaging facet of a standard uniform than as a safeguard in the direction of dishonest.
There’s additionally the notion, popularized by depictions in tv and film, that gunslingers of the Outdated West wore sleeve garters to allow protect their fingers cost-free within the perform of a shootout. Nevertheless, the notorious inaccuracy of pistols and handguns from the time interval, included to the straightforward undeniable fact that the American frontier was usually significantly a lot much less violent than its depiction in pop way of life, tends to make this rationale unlikely. Nonetheless, there isn’t any dilemma that the sleeve garter is now, because it was then, considered a dashing accent for any effectively-dressed gunslinger from that interval.
There’s additionally a perception that preserving one’s arms completely free designed arm garters well-known between guitarists and early jazz musicians. Despite the fact that there’s possible some validity to this sense, sleeve garters had been additionally well-known amongst singers and different non-instrument taking part in performers of the time, lending potent proof to the thought that arm garters had been as fashionable as they had been being helpful.
Retro Method and the Return of the Sleeve Garter
The cease of the Previous West, blended with technological progress and enormous alterations in style all through the twentieth century, has turned arm garters right into a relic of the previous, an individual that’s now small excess of facet of a dressing up minimal to a few vastly nostalgic professions. There’s, nevertheless, proof that arm garters could maybe be making a factor of 2nd comeback.
The aesthetic recognized as steampunk, which mixes and blends the electrical energy of punk audio, the enhancements of modern applied sciences, and the search and kind of Victorian method, has recently begun to have an effect on fictional literature, artwork, new music, movie, and significantly garments. Lovers of this new and normally whimsical mannequin are recognized to incorporate dated gear like sleeve garters into their gown — the world large internet pretty abounds with how-to guides and pointers that present followers the right way to sew sleeve garters of their possess.
No matter whether or not fads like steampunk will restore the sleeve garter to a premier spot in males’s style continues to be to be seen, however the movement is proof that the particular search of this really aged faculty accent is nonetheless well-known for some, and is way from concluded.
